dc.description The availability of dam fill materials influenced the dam design considerably. Rockfill is one of the most preferred fill materials for embankment dam. Also, use of different fill material such as sand-gravel has been preferred in recent years. Previous studies on concrete-faced sand-gravel fill dam, results of the laboratory experiments and in situ testing analysis display that using sand-gravel as a fill material is not only cost-effective but also safe and provides high-quality natural construction material. This paper illustrates the importance of construction material properties on dam type selection. Sariguzel Dam is constructed on the Ceyhan River to the south-west of the Turkey. In the feasibility stage, the dam type was selected as the concrete-facing rockfill dam, depending on state of natural construction materials. Because of the inappropriate rock material quality, in design stage dam type was changed to concrete-faced sand-gravel fill type.
